The New Orleans Pelicans moved to 20-44 after a 133-123 road result over the the Sacramento Kings, who went to 14-50 at Golden 1 Center.

First quarter
The Pelicans opened with 26 points in the first quarter while the Kings posted 30 points in the same quarter.
Sacramento grabbed early momentum with 7 lead changes in the game and a 9-point biggest lead that started taking shape in the opening stretch.
Second quarter
The Pelicans surged for 41 points in the second quarter as the Kings scored 33 points in the frame.
New Orleans leaned on a 68-point total in the paint and paired it with 27 assists to keep the ball moving.
This New Orleans Pelicans vs Sacramento Kings match summary included 50 bench points for the Pels compared with 43 from Sactown.
Third quarter
The Pelicans produced 38 points in the third quarter while the Kings added 28 points coming out of halftime.
New Orleans controlled extra chances with 61 total rebounds and 14 offensive rebounds, while Sacramento finished with 49 rebounds and 10 offensive boards.
The Pels protected the rim with 11 blocks, and
Yves Missi supplied 4 blocks as part of his 7-point line.
Fourth quarter
The Pelicans scored 28 points in the fourth quarter while the Kings scored 32 points as Sacramento tried to close the gap.
New Orleans shot 85 percent at the line on 27 free throw attempts, and Sacramento hit 65 percent on 23 attempts.
Zion Williamson led the Pels scoring from the rostered names with 23 points and added 9 rebounds.
Trey Murphy III backed that with 21 points, and
Jeremiah Fears added 6 assists to support the Pelicans’ 2.45 assists-to-turnover ratio.
Sacramento finished at 26 percent from 3-point range on 31 attempts, while the Pelicans hit 35 percent on 34 attempts, which shaped the New Orleans Pelicans vs Sacramento Kings highlights.
The Kings still generated 29 assists and 21 fast break points, but the Pelicans answered with 19 fast break points on 53 percent conversion.
The New Orleans Pelicans match rating in the box score was driven by 50 percent shooting on 98 field goal attempts and a 60 percent true shooting rate, which rounds out the post game analysis.
